Single-pole voltage tester for checking for the presence of AC voltage in electrical installations. A tool intended for basic verification measurements at mains voltage levels.
The tester detects AC voltage across a range that covers standard domestic installations (230V) as well as older installations (110V). An indicator lamp lights up when voltage is present, allowing the status of the circuit to be checked quickly.
The tester's length provides a suitable distance from live parts while remaining easy to handle. Its dimensions make it easy to carry in a work pocket or tool bag.
The body is made from insulating material, providing protection against electric shock. The transparent construction allows the internal components and the indicator bulb to be inspected visually.

A single-pole voltage tester works on the principle of a small current flowing through the user's body to earth. When the probe tip is touched to a live conductor and the metal contact at the end of the handle is touched with a finger at the same time, the circuit is completed through the body's capacitance to earth. The resulting microcurrent (safe for humans) lights the indicator bulb. For this reason, the tester requires contact with the metal contact – without it, no measurement is possible.
Before testing, check that the tester is working on a circuit of known voltage. To test, touch the probe tip to the point being tested and place a finger on the metal contact at the end of the handle. Illumination of the lamp indicates the presence of voltage.
The tester does not show the voltage value – it is used solely to detect whether voltage is present. It is not suitable for precise measurements or for use with voltages below 100V or above 250V. It does not detect DC voltage. It is not a substitute for professional meters when diagnosing advanced faults.
Regularly check the condition of the probe tip – mechanical damage can affect measurement accuracy. Check the transparent handle for cracks. If there is no indication at a known voltage, replace the internal bulb. Store in a dry place, away from sources of moisture.
